Split backspace support is very difficult when it comes LED's. As with the Slice keyboard, decisions were made about it early on. There are usually a few options but none turn out very well.
1. Allow split backspace but keep the LED in the center causing glare or glow between the keys.
2. Allow split backspace and don't allow backspace to have an LED at all.
3. Allow split backspace but bypass led so when backspace is split, no led will illuminate.
All these options are just really not good in my opinion. SK6812MINI-E leds used in this board are chain connected, so you can't leave one out. There is a way to split 1 led in the chain into 2, but the stabilizers are in the way. I've always tried to restrict the layout when LEDs are involved. With the slice, I feel that it was a good decision to have a really customizable one with no leds and a strict layout with leds.
